Evel Knievel, born Robert Craig Knievel Jr. in 1938, began his daredevil career in the late 1960s, initially performing motorcycle stunts in small-town events. He started by jumping over cars and small gaps, gradually building his reputation and audience. His big break came in 1967 when he attempted to set a world record by jumping over the fountains at Caesar’s Palace in Las Vegas. Although the attempt ended in a crash that left him severely injured, it also catapulted him to fame, as the event was captured on film and widely publicized.
